Understanding Psychiatry
Psychiatry is a branch of medication concentrated on diagnosing, treating, and preventing mental health problems. Psychiatrists are medical physicians who can recommend medications, carry out physical exams, and offer numerous forms of therapy. Discovering the ideal psychiatrist involves a number of considerations. Here are some key factors to keep in mind:
Credentials and Specialization: Ensure the psychiatrist is board-certified and has the proper certifications. Try to find any expertise that lines up with your particular requirements (e.g., anxiety conditions, depression, dependency).Area: Consider the benefit of the psychiatrist's office area, as frequent check outs might be required.Insurance Coverage: Check if the psychiatrist accepts your insurance coverage, if relevant. When meeting with a psychiatrist for the very first time, think about asking the following questions:
What is your experience in treating my specific condition?What is your treatment approach?What are the possible adverse effects of the medication you may prescribe?How typically do you usually set up follow-up visits?Are there extra therapies or assistance groups you recommend?Frequently asked questions

How do I determine if I require to see a psychiatrist?If you are experiencing consistent mental health symptoms, such as anxiety, depression, state of mind swings, or behavioral modifications that interrupt every day life, it may be an indication to seek the aid of a psychiatrist. 2. Is my details private with a psychiatrist?Yes, psychiatristsare bound by confidentiality laws and principles. However, there are exceptions, such as if there is a risk of harm to oneself or others. 3. How long does treatment usually last with a psychiatrist?Treatment period differs commonly based upon private requirements, the seriousness of conditions, and the treatment method. Some may require just a couple of sessions, while others may engage in long-lasting treatment. 4. Can a psychiatrist prescribe medication without therapy?Yes, psychiatrists can prescribe medication for mental health conditions without providing treatment.

Nevertheless, a combined method typically yields the best results. 5.
What is the difference between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?Psychiatrists are medical doctors who can prescribe medication and offer therapy, while psychologists generally concentrate on psychiatric therapyand do not prescribe medication(in most states).
